3D-aruco-generator

Generate 3D models of aruco markers to 3D print. Renders the aruco as a square box with grooves for the black squares.

Requirements

The recommended way to install the requirements is to use a virtual environment:

python3 -m venv aruco_3d_env
source aruco_3d_env/bin/activate
python3 -m pip install --upgrade pip  # cadquery requires pip upgrade
pip install -r requirements.txt

In Ubuntu you have to defer to the system package manager for the following packages:

export FONTCONFIG_FILE=/etc/fonts/fonts.conf

Usage

To generate an STL file of an aruco marker, run the following command, and you will be prompted for the marker properties (marker ID, marker size, etc.):

python3 generate_aruco.py

for CLI options, run:

python3 generate_aruco.py --help

Layer height

The idea is to have 1 or 2 layers of depth for the groove to paint the marker black. In our experience paint such as "musou black" vastly improves readability of the marker. As it prevents the marker from reflecting light.
